Key Market Indicators
Demand for compressors in Benin is expected to decrease at a rate of 4.4% per year over the next five years. In 2021, the country imported 17,100 kilograms of compressors, and this is projected to drop to 13,130 kilograms by 2026. Since 2003, demand for compressors has grown by an average of 4.7% annually. Benin's compressor exports are forecast to decrease by 17.7% per year over the next five years. In 2021, the country exported 995 kilograms of compressors, with Moldova surpassing Benin in this ranking. Thailand, South Korea and Slovakia were the next three countries in this ranking. Since 2008, Benin's export of compressors has seen a downward trend of 3.1% each year.
